Di Vaio gets Lippi assurances Monday 9 September, 2002
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Juventus boss Marcello Lippi has maintained that Marco Di Vaio will not simply be an alternative to David Trezeguet.
The former Parma hitman, 24, was brought in by the Delle Alpi club this summer amidst fears that Trezeguet could need knee surgery.
But Lippi has maintained that the international, who cost £16m and the one year loan sacrifice of midfielder Matteo Brighi to the Gialloblu, is not a back-up striker.
"He is not cover for Trezeguet and he will be very useful for us this season," said the Juve tactician.
"We have an extra quality player this term which we couldn’t count on last year. I will also try playing with a trident strike force with Di Vaio and Alex Del Piero supporting Trezeguet."
Lippi added: "You will see many different types of Juventus this season because I will adapt the system of play in order to compliment the characteristics of the players that I select."
The Delle Alpi outfit now have a number of attacking options with Di Vaio’s late arrival.
Apart from Del Piero and Trezeguet, Lippi can also count on Chilean international Marcelo Salas, plus the Uruguayan duo of Marcelo Zalayeta and Ruben Olivera.
